Output 5c3b5e1c31be40452eac20f4136ff189753d9c57e3005ed859bfaa3a91bb634a:45

value
589790078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dbad9f508d281186ddbdcfa31ab39f1c960dabe OP_EQUAL
address
34QDMmaRqJqd9Qphm44zNSA15ZqKr57c2v
transaction
5c3b5e1c31be40452eac20f4136ff189753d9c57e3005ed859bfaa3a91bb634a
spent
true